Union Tourism and Culture Minister G Kishan Reddy flagged off four train services at Secunderabad Railway Station. These services include extending the Hadapsar-Hyderabad Express up to Kazipet, Jaipur-Kacheguda Express up to Kurnool City, HS Nanded-Tandur Express up to Raichur, and Karimnagar-Nizamabad MEMU train up to Bodhan.

According to SCR officials, the extensions aim to provide additional travel facilities and cater to the needs of people in the Telangana region. The residents of Kazipet will now have direct night travel options to Pune, and those from Shadnagar, Mahbubnagar, Gadwal, and Kurnool city can travel directly to Jaipur. Similarly, people from Sedam, Chittapur, Yadgir, and Raichur can go to Nanded, and locals of Bodhan can travel to Karimnagar.
